Almond Butter Crunch Recipe

Ingredients:

1 1/4 cups sugar, white or brown
1 cup butter (not margarine)
1 tbsp corn syrup
3 tbsp water
1 cup sliced or slivered almonds (I always lightly browned them in the micro)
6 ounce. chocolate chips
2-4 tbsp almonds for sprinkling

Directions:

1. Boil to card-crack stage, 310 F (152 C), the sugar, butter, syrup and water. Please use a candy thermometer.
2. Remove from heat, add almonds, stir and pour onto cookie sheet. Work quickly.
3. Melt chocolate chips and spread over candy. I usually did not melt the chips just spread them over the hot mixture and they melt enough to spread over the surface. Sprinkle with extra almonds.
4. Refrigerate until very cold. Break into pieces.
